#mahdollisuuksien-tyopiste-quiz{display:flex;flex-direction:column;min-height:100vh;overflow:hidden;padding:25px;position:relative;word-break:break-word}#mahdollisuuksien-tyopiste-quiz .logo-header{min-height:80px;padding-bottom:38px;text-align:center}#mahdollisuuksien-tyopiste-quiz .heading,#mahdollisuuksien-tyopiste-quiz h1,#mahdollisuuksien-tyopiste-quiz h2{color:#660009}#mahdollisuuksien-tyopiste-quiz h1{font-size:3rem}#mahdollisuuksien-tyopiste-quiz h2,#mahdollisuuksien-tyopiste-quiz p{margin-bottom:0}#mahdollisuuksien-tyopiste-quiz button{background:#306ef7;color:#fff;transition:.5s ease-out}#mahdollisuuksien-tyopiste-quiz button:hover{background:#134a9c}#mahdollisuuksien-tyopiste-quiz .intro p,#mahdollisuuksien-tyopiste-quiz h1{margin:0 auto;max-width:30rem}#mahdollisuuksien-tyopiste-quiz .wrapper{display:flex;justify-content:flex-end;width:100%}#mahdollisuuksien-tyopiste-quiz .content{align-items:center;display:flex;flex-direction:column;gap:30px;justify-content:center;padding-right:25px;text-align:center;width:52%}#mahdollisuuksien-tyopiste-quiz .main-background-area{background-size:cover;flex-grow:1}#mahdollisuuksien-tyopiste-quiz .changeable-content{display:flex;flex-direction:column;gap:30px;justify-content:center;max-width:592px;padding:35px 0;width:100%}#mahdollisuuksien-tyopiste-quiz .changeable-content.question.hidden{display:none;height:0;overflow:hidden}#mahdollisuuksien-tyopiste-quiz .character{left:61px;opacity:0;position:absolute;top:165px;transform:translateX(-100px);transition:all 1s ease-out;visibility:hidden;width:45%}#mahdollisuuksien-tyopiste-quiz .partners{padding-bottom:65px;padding-top:65px}#mahdollisuuksien-tyopiste-quiz .partners h2{color:#000}#mahdollisuuksien-tyopiste-quiz .partner-logos{display:flex;flex-wrap:wrap;gap:16px;justify-content:center}#mahdollisuuksien-tyopiste-quiz .back-arrow-element{align-items:center;background:#fff;color:#306ef7;cursor:pointer;display:flex;font-size:38.75px;font-style:normal;font-weight:500;gap:20px;line-height:normal;padding:12px 12px 12px 0;position:absolute;top:15px;transform:translateX(0);transition:all .5s ease-out}#mahdollisuuksien-tyopiste-quiz .back-arrow-element.hidden{transform:translateX(-100%)}#mahdollisuuksien-tyopiste-quiz .choices{display:flex;flex-wrap:wrap;gap:10px;justify-content:center}#mahdollisuuksien-tyopiste-quiz .choice-button,#mahdollisuuksien-tyopiste-quiz button.choice-button{align-items:center;background:#fff;border:2px solid transparent;border-radius:100px;color:#000;display:flex;gap:10px;padding:10px 20px;width:fit-content}#mahdollisuuksien-tyopiste-quiz .choice-button:hover{border:2px solid #306ef7}#mahdollisuuksien-tyopiste-quiz .choice-button span{max-width:calc(100% - 29px);pointer-events:none}#mahdollisuuksien-tyopiste-quiz .choice-button svg{border-radius:100%}#mahdollisuuksien-tyopiste-quiz .choice-button.selected{background-color:#306ef7;border:2px solid #306ef7;color:#fff}#mahdollisuuksien-tyopiste-quiz .choice-button.selected circle{fill:#306ef7;stroke:#fff;stroke-width:7px}#mahdollisuuksien-tyopiste-quiz .splide{display:flex;justify-content:center}#mahdollisuuksien-tyopiste-quiz .splide__track{max-width:592px;width:100%}#mahdollisuuksien-tyopiste-quiz .splide__pagination{bottom:unset;left:unset;opacity:0;right:0;top:-63px;transform:translateX(200px);visibility:hidden;width:fit-content}#mahdollisuuksien-tyopiste-quiz .splide__pagination.show{opacity:1;transform:translateX(0);transition:all .5s ease-out;visibility:visible}#mahdollisuuksien-tyopiste-quiz button.splide__pagination__page{background:transparent;border:2px solid #306ef7;height:20px;opacity:1;pointer-events:none;width:20px}#mahdollisuuksien-tyopiste-quiz button.splide__pagination__page.is-active{background-color:#306ef7;transform:none}#mahdollisuuksien-tyopiste-quiz .form-title{display:none}#mahdollisuuksien-tyopiste-quiz form label{text-align:left}#mahdollisuuksien-tyopiste-quiz form .hs-button,form input[type=submit]{background:#306ef7;color:#fff;width:auto}#mahdollisuuksien-tyopiste-quiz button.calculate-points{background:transparent;color:#000;margin:0 auto;text-align:center;width:fit-content}#mahdollisuuksien-tyopiste-quiz .show{opacity:1;transform:translateX(0);visibility:visible}@media screen and (max-width:800px){#mahdollisuuksien-tyopiste-quiz{min-height:unset}#mahdollisuuksien-tyopiste-quiz .heading{font-size:24px}#mahdollisuuksien-tyopiste-quiz p{margin:0}#mahdollisuuksien-tyopiste-quiz .logo-header{min-height:50px;padding:0}#mahdollisuuksien-tyopiste-quiz .content{padding-left:15px;padding-right:15px;width:75%}#mahdollisuuksien-tyopiste-quiz.not-first-slide .content{width:100%}#mahdollisuuksien-tyopiste-quiz .changeable-content{gap:10px;padding:15px 0}#mahdollisuuksien-tyopiste-quiz .changeable-content.intro{gap:30px;justify-content:flex-start;padding-top:53px}#mahdollisuuksien-tyopiste-quiz .partners .content{width:100%}#mahdollisuuksien-tyopiste-quiz .character{left:0}#mahdollisuuksien-tyopiste-quiz .back-arrow-element{font-size:24px;gap:10px}#mahdollisuuksien-tyopiste-quiz .back-arrow-element svg{width:30px}#mahdollisuuksien-tyopiste-quiz .back-arrow{align-items:center;display:flex}#mahdollisuuksien-tyopiste-quiz .splide__pagination{top:-45px}}